Being harmed or mistreated in a psychiatric facility or mental health setting

Being harmed, mistreated, or re-traumatized in a psychiatric hospital, residential treatment facility, or mental health setting. Treatment that felt more like punishment. Staff who used their power against you rather than for you. A system that was supposed to help with your mental health and instead made it worse.

Being harmed in a place you were sent to for healing bends the compass that points toward help. If treatment felt like punishment, or the staff's power was used against you, wariness of the entire mental health world is a sane response. This fellowship is not that system. Nobody here holds power over you, which is exactly the point.

Nothing on this page is a diagnosis, and nothing here decides what is wrong with you, because nothing is wrong with you. Something happened to you. This page exists so that when you are ready, you can find people who understand it from the inside.
